Pregnant 21-year-old dies by suicide after alleged dowry harassment
A 21-year-old pregnant woman, Sonali Samadhan Chandanshive, was found dead by suicide in Vadapuri, Indapur taluka, Pune district on Thursday, according to police reports. Sonali, who was five months pregnant, had allegedly faced harassment from her in-laws demanding Rs 1 lakh, following her marriage to Samadhan Gautam Chandanshive in November 2025.
The incident allegedly began when the in-laws started pressuring Sonali's maternal family for the money, which they claimed was needed for purchasing a flat. When the demanded sum was not provided, Sonali alleges that she was subjected to verbal abuse, physical violence, and was denied food. Sonali's father informed the police about the alleged harassment after she confided in him about the treatment she received at her in-laws' home.
Upon hearing the news, Sonali's body was discovered hanging at the in-laws' residence in Vadapuri, leading to her declaration of death at a nearby government hospital. The Indapur Police have registered a case against the accused, including Sonali's husband, mother-in-law, and father-in-law, under sections 80(2) (dowry death), 108 (abetment of suicide), and 3(5) of the Bharatiya Nyaya Sanhita (BNS).
Inspector Vilas Nale of the Indapur Police Station stated that the police are currently investigating the matter.
